# **About the Role:** **Grade Level (for internal use):** 09 **Software Developer II** with the SPG Salesforce team will be responsible for providing backend support to our Salesforce and cloud-based CRM platforms. Together, he/she will build scalable and robust solutions using AGILE development methodologies with a focus on high availability to end users. How to Apply on Workday

  • Workday has a multi-step form — save your progress after every section.
  • "Apply With LinkedIn" can fail or lose data; manual entry is more reliable.
  • Watch for the "Submit for Review" final step — hitting "Save" alone does not submit.
  • Job requisition numbers are useful when following up with HR by email.
